sometimes i feel like i am at my peak.
like nothing i do could possibly feel better.
sometimes i feel low that i just want to quit everything.
i get drowned in stress from everything going on around me.
wrapped around a pole with confusion.
filled to the rim.
filled with anything and everything that could possibly bring me down.
but i hold it together.
because moments like these,
days like today,
make everything worth it.
my time.
my effort.
worth my everything.
my dream since i can remember.
my goal since forever.
it was worth all the hard work,
every ounce of stress,
because for once,
I am worth watching.

The author's comments:
I wrote this poem after I called my father to tell him I made the varsity basketball team. My dad had never been to one of my games for he lived in a different state. He always pushed me to do well in sports, but every time I looked out into the bleachers, I was hit again and again with the disappointment of him not being there. The fact that he had told me he would try to make it to one of my games during that phone call swirled so many different emotions. And that, is show this poem was created.
